Claims
- 1. A telecommunications network device, comprising: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a switched control path coupled to the plurality of distributed processors.
- 2. The telecommunications network device of claim 1, wherein the switched control path is a first switched control path and further comprising:
a second switched control path coupled to the plurality of distributed processors.
- 3. The telecommunications network device of claim 2, wherein the first and second switched control paths comprise redundant switched control paths.
- 4. The telecommunications network device of claim 1, wherein the switched control path comprises an Ethernet switch.
- 5. The telecommunications network device of claim 4, wherein the Ethernet switch comprises:
an Ethernet switch subsystem; and a plurality of physical Ethernet port chips coupled to the Ethernet switch subsystem, wherein each of the plurality of distributed processors is coupled with at least one of the plurality of physical Ethernet port chips.
- 6. The telecommunications network device of claim 5, wherein the plurality of physical Ethernet port chips is a first plurality of physical Ethernet port chips and the Ethernet switch subsystem comprises:
an Ethernet switch chip; and a second plurality of physical Ethernet port chips coupled with the Ethernet switch chip, wherein the second plurality of Ethernet port chips are further coupled with the first plurality of physical Ethernet port chips.
- 7. The telecommunications network device of claim 1, wherein the switched control path comprises a proprietary bus.
- 8. The telecommunications network device of claim 1, wherein the switched control path comprises an Asynchronous Transfer Mode network.
- 9. The telecommunications network device of claim 1, wherein the switched control path comprises a Multi-Protocol Label Switching network.
- 10. The telecommunications network device of claim 1, fuirther comprising:
a plurality of cards, wherein at least one of the plurality of processors is mounted on each of the plurality of cards.
- 11. The telecommunications network device of claim 1, wherein at least a portion of the plurality of distributed processors are coupled to the switched control path through multiple independent ports.
- 12. The telecommunications network device of claim 1, further comprising: an external port coupled with the switched control plane.
- 13. A telecommunications network device, comprising: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a control path, including a plurality of control links, wherein at least one of the plurality of control links is coupled with each of the plurality of distributed processors.
- 14. The telecommunications network device of claim 13, wherein the control links comprise:
Ethernet ports.
- 15. A telecommunications network device, comprising: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a control path coupled to the plurality of distributed processors, wherein separate control path resources are dedicated to each of the plurality of distributed processors.
- 16. The telecommunications network device of claim 16, wherein the separate control path resources comprise:
an Ethernet port.
- 17. A telecommunications network, comprising:
a plurality of network devices, wherein at least a portion of the plurality of network devices each comprise: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a switched control path coupled to the plurality of distributed processors.
- 18. The telecommunications network of claim 17, wherein the switched control path within each of the portion of the plurality of network devices is connected together as a multi-chassis switched control path.
- 19. A telecommunications network, comprising:
a plurality of network devices, wherein at least a portion of the plurality of network devices each comprise: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a control path, including a plurality of control links, wherein at least one of the plurality of c ontrol links is coupled with each of the plurality of d istributed p rocessors.
- 20. The telecommunications network of claim 19, wherein the control path within each of the portion of the plurality of network devices is connected together as a multi-chassis control path.
- 21. A telecommunications network, comprising:
a plurality of network devices, wherein at least a portion of the plurality of network devices each comprise:
a plurality of distributed processors; a data path coupled to the plurality of distributed processors; and a control path coupled to the plurality of distributed processors, wherein separate control path resources are dedicated to each of the plurality of distributed processors.
- 22. The telecommunications network of claim 21, wherein the control path within each of the portion of the plurality of network devices is connected together as a multi-chassis control path.
- 23. A method of managing a telecommunications network device including a plurality of distributed processors, comprising:
transmitting network data through a data path within the network device; and transmitting control information between the plurality of distributed processors through a switched control path.
- 24. The method of claim 23, wherein the switched control path is an Ethernet switch.
- 25. The method of claim 23, wherein the switched control path is an A synchronous Transfer Mode network.
- 26. The method of claim 23, wherein the switched control path is a Multi-Protocol Label Switching (MPLS) network.
- 27. The method of claim 23, wherein the switched control path is a proprietary bus.
- 28. A method of managing a telecommunications network device including a plurality of distributed processors, comprising:
transmitting network data through a data path within the network device; and transmitting control information between the plurality of distributed processors through a plurality of control links in a control path, wherein at least one of the plurality of control links is dedicated to each of the plurality of distributed processors.
- 29. A method of managing a telecommunications network device including a plurality of distributed processors, comprising:
transmitting network data through a data path within the network device; and transmitting control information between the plurality of distributed processors through a control path, wherein separate control path resources are dedicated to each of the plurality of distributed processors.
- 30. A method of managing a telecommunications network including a plurality of network devices, wherein at least a portion of the plurality of network devices each includes a plurality of distributed processors and a control path coupling the plurality of distributed processors, comprising:
connecting each of the control paths in the portion of the plurality of network devices; and transmitting control information between the plurality of network devices through the connected control paths.
- 31. The method of claim 30, wherein each control path comprises a switched control path.
- 32. The method of claim 30, wherein the switched control paths comprise Ethernet switches.
- 33. The method of claim 30, wherein each control path dedicates control path resources to each of the plurality of processors within the network device.
- 34. The method of claim 30, wherein each control path dedicates a control link to each of the plurality of processor within the network device.
Parent Case Info
[0001] This application is a continuation-in-part of U.S. Ser. No. ______, filed Apr. 10, 2001, entitled “Common Command Interface” still pending, which is a continuation-inpart of U.S. Ser. No. 09/803,783, filed Mar. 12, 2001, entitled “VPI/VCI Availability Index” still pending, which is a continuation-in-part of U.S. Ser. No. 09/789,665 filed Feb. 21, 2001, entitled “Out-Of-Band Network Management Channels” still pending, which is a continuation-in-part of U.S. Ser. No. 09/777,468, filed Feb. 5, 2001, entitled “Signatures for Facilitating Hot Upgrades of Modular Software Components”, still pending, which is a continuation-in-part of U.S. Ser. No. 09/756,936, filed Jan. 9, 2001, entitled “Network Device Power Distribution Scheme”, which is a continuation-in-part of U.S. Ser. No. 09/718,224, filed Nov. 21, 2000, entitled “Internal Network Device Dynamic Health Monitoring, which is a continuation-in-part of U.S. Ser. No. 09/711,054, filed Nov. 9, 2000, entitled “Network Device Identity Authentication”, which is a continuation-in-part of U.S. Ser. No. 09/703,856, filed Nov. 1, 2000, entitled “Accessing Network Device Data Through User Profiles”, which is a continuation-in-part of U.S. Ser. No. 09/687,191, filed Oct. 12, 2000 entitled “Utilizing Managed Object Proxies in Network Management Systems”, which is a continuation-in-part of U.S. Ser. No. 09/669,364, filed Sep. 26, 2000 entitled “Distributed Statistical Data Retrieval in a Network Device”, which is a continuation-in-part of U.S. Ser. No. 09/663,947, filed Sep. 18, 2000, entitled “Network Management System Including Custom Object Collections, which is a continuation-in-part of U.S. Ser. No. 09/656,123, filed Sep. 6, 2000, entitled “Network Management System Including Dynamic Bulletin Boards”, which is a continuation-in-part of U.S. Ser. No. 09/653,700, filed Aug. 31, 2000, entitled “Network Management System Including SONET Path Configuration Wizard”, which is a continuation-in-part of U.S. Ser. No. 09/637,800, filed Aug. 11, 2000, entitled “Processing Network Management Data In Accordance with Metadata Files”, which is a continuation-in-part of U.S. Ser. No. 09/633,675, filed Aug. 7, 2000, entitled “Integrating Operations Support Services with Network Management Systems”, which is a continuation-in-part of U.S. Ser. No. 09/625,101, filed Jul. 24, 2000, entitled “Model Driven Synchronization of Telecommunications Processes”, which is a continuation-in-part of U.S. Ser. No. 09/616,477, filed Jul. 14, 2000, entitled “Upper Layer Network Device Including a Physical Layer Test Port”, which is a continuation-in-part of U.S. Ser. No. 09/613,940, filed Jul. 11, 2000, entitled “Network Device Including Central and Distributed Switch Fabric Sub-Systems”, which is a continuation-in-part of U.S. Ser. No. 09/596,055, filed Jun. 16, 2000, entitled “A Multi Layer Device in One Telco Rack”, which is a continuation-in-part of U.S. Ser. No. 09/593,034, filed Jun. 13, 2000, entitled “A Network Device for Supporting Multiple Upper Layer Protocols Over a Single Network Connection”, which is a continuation and part of U.S. Ser. No. 09/574,440, filed May 20, 2000, entitled Vertical Fault Isolation in a Computer System” and U.S. Ser. No. 09/591,193, filed Jun. 9, 2000 entitled “A Network Device for Supporting Multiple Redundancy Schemes”, which is a continuation-in-part of U.S. Ser. No. 09/588,398, filed Jun. 6, 2000, entitled “Time Synchronization Within a Distributed Processing System”, which is a continuation-in-part of U.S. Ser. No. 09/574,341, filed May 20, 2000, entitled “Policy Based Provisioning of Network Device Resources” and U.S. Ser. No. 09/574,343, filed May 20, 2000, entitled “Functional Separation of Internal and External Controls in Network Devices”.